Uttarakhand Police Files Two FIRs Amid New Allegations in Ankita Bhandari Murder Case

The Uttarakhand Police has filed two FIRs related to fresh allegations in the Ankita Bhandari murder case. Authorities are seeking public assistance for evidence while ensuring a thorough investigation.

The Uttarakhand Police have initiated two FIRs following allegations in a social media video linked to the 2022 Ankita Bhandari murder case. Additional Director General of Police Law and Order, Dr. V Murugesan, stated that legal action will be taken based on the investigation's findings. He urged the public to provide any evidence related to the murder.

Dr. Murugesan described the murder of the receptionist as a highly unfortunate and sensitive matter. After the incident, the state government quickly formed a Special Investigation Team led by a female IPS officer. This team swiftly arrested all suspects and ensured they remained in custody without bail.

Investigation and Legal Proceedings

During the investigation and subsequent trial, petitions were submitted to both the high court and the Supreme Court. These petitions sought to transfer the case's investigation to the Central Bureau of Investigation. However, both courts found the SIT's investigation fair, transparent, and lawful, rejecting these requests.

The lower court ultimately sentenced all three accused individuals to life imprisonment. The recent FIRs are connected to a viral video featuring Urmila Sanawar, who is reportedly married to former BJP MLA Suresh Rathore, along with an audio recording of her alleged conversation with Rathore.

Political Implications and Allegations

In her video, Sanawar claimed that a person named Gattu is the same VIP involved in Ankita's murder case. Another video by Sanawar disclosed Gattu's identity, sparking accusations and counter-accusations within Uttarakhand's political landscape.

The police are investigating these new allegations thoroughly. Dr. Murugesan assured that any emerging facts would lead to appropriate legal actions. The police remain committed to ensuring justice for Ankita Bhandari.
